当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储能存储结构化数据吗是什么,对象存储与结构化数据,兼容性分析及实践应用探讨

对象存储能存储结构化数据吗是什么,对象存储与结构化数据,兼容性分析及实践应用探讨

对象存储能存储结构化数据。本文分析了对象存储与结构化数据的兼容性,探讨了其在实际应用中的实践方法,为用户选择合适的存储方案提供参考。...

对象存储能存储结构化数据。本文分析了对象存储与结构化数据的兼容性,探讨了其在实际应用中的实践方法,为用户选择合适的存储方案提供参考。

随着大数据时代的到来,数据存储需求日益增长,传统的文件存储系统已经无法满足海量数据的高效存储和访问需求,近年来,对象存储作为一种新型的数据存储技术,因其高效、可靠、可扩展等特点,逐渐成为数据存储领域的研究热点,关于对象存储能否存储结构化数据的问题,业界存在诸多争议,本文将对此问题进行深入探讨,分析对象存储与结构化数据的兼容性,并结合实际应用场景,提出相应的解决方案。

对象存储概述

1、对象存储定义

对象存储是一种基于对象的分布式存储技术,将数据存储在多个节点上,每个节点负责存储一部分数据,对象存储系统由存储节点、元数据服务器和客户端组成,客户端通过HTTP协议与元数据服务器进行交互,实现对数据的存储、检索和访问。

2、对象存储特点

对象存储能存储结构化数据吗是什么,对象存储与结构化数据,兼容性分析及实践应用探讨

(1)高扩展性:对象存储系统采用分布式架构,可轻松扩展存储容量,满足海量数据存储需求。

(2)高可靠性:对象存储系统采用数据冗余机制,确保数据在节点故障的情况下仍然可用。

(3)高吞吐量:对象存储系统支持并发访问,可满足大规模数据处理的性能需求。

(4)易用性:对象存储系统采用HTTP协议,客户端访问方便,易于与其他应用集成。

结构化数据概述

1、结构化数据定义

结构化数据是指具有固定格式、能够用二维表格结构表示的数据,如关系型数据库中的表、Excel表格等。

2、结构化数据特点

(1)数据格式固定:结构化数据具有固定的字段和字段类型,便于数据存储和检索。

(2)易于管理:结构化数据便于进行数据备份、恢复、归档等操作。

对象存储能存储结构化数据吗是什么,对象存储与结构化数据,兼容性分析及实践应用探讨

(3)易于分析:结构化数据便于进行数据分析、挖掘等操作。

对象存储与结构化数据的兼容性分析

1、兼容性问题

对象存储与结构化数据的兼容性主要表现在以下几个方面:

(1)数据格式:对象存储采用JSON、XML等格式存储数据,而结构化数据通常采用关系型数据库或Excel等格式,这导致数据在存储和访问过程中存在格式转换的问题。

(2)数据结构:对象存储的数据结构较为松散,而结构化数据具有严格的字段和字段类型约束,这导致数据在存储和访问过程中存在结构转换的问题。

(3)数据访问:对象存储的数据访问通常通过HTTP协议进行,而结构化数据访问通常通过SQL语句进行,这导致数据在访问过程中存在接口转换的问题。

2、解决方案

(1)数据格式转换:针对数据格式问题,可以采用数据转换工具或编写程序实现数据格式的转换,如将结构化数据转换为JSON格式。

(2)数据结构转换:针对数据结构问题,可以采用数据映射技术,将对象存储中的数据结构映射为结构化数据格式,如将对象存储中的嵌套结构映射为关系型数据库中的表。

对象存储能存储结构化数据吗是什么,对象存储与结构化数据,兼容性分析及实践应用探讨

(3)数据访问接口转换:针对数据访问接口问题,可以采用适配器技术,将对象存储的HTTP接口转换为结构化数据的SQL接口,或编写程序实现接口的转换。

实践应用探讨

1、数据迁移

在数据迁移过程中,可以利用对象存储与结构化数据的兼容性,实现数据格式的转换、结构转换和接口转换,提高数据迁移效率。

2、数据共享

在数据共享过程中,可以利用对象存储的高效、可靠、可扩展等特点,实现结构化数据的存储和访问,降低数据共享成本。

3、数据分析

在数据分析过程中,可以利用对象存储与结构化数据的兼容性,将结构化数据转换为对象存储格式,提高数据分析效率。

本文通过对对象存储与结构化数据的兼容性分析,探讨了对象存储在存储结构化数据方面的优势和挑战,通过采用数据格式转换、数据结构转换和数据访问接口转换等技术,可以解决对象存储与结构化数据之间的兼容性问题,在实际应用中,对象存储在数据迁移、数据共享和数据分析等方面具有广泛的应用前景,随着技术的不断发展,对象存储与结构化数据的兼容性将得到进一步提升,为数据存储领域带来更多创新应用。

黑狐家游戏

发表评论

最新文章